What is Turkish Lira (TRY)

The Turkish Lira (TRY) is the official currency of Turkey and the Turkish Republic of Northern Cyprus. It plays a crucial role in the Turkish economy and is divided into 100 kuruş. The modern lira replaced the old Turkish lira in 2005 when the government introduced a series of reforms to stabilize the economy and reduce high inflation rates.

The symbol for the Turkish Lira is ₺, and it is commonly represented as "TRY" in international finance. As a member of the G20, Turkey is an important emerging market, which can influence the value of the Lira. Various factors, such as political stability, economic performance, and changes in interest rates, all contribute to fluctuations in the currency's value.

What is Comoros Franc (KMF)

The Comoros Franc (KMF) is the official currency used in the Comoros, an archipelago located between Madagascar and the eastern coast of Africa. The Comoros Franc is subdivided into 100 centimes. The currency is symbolized by "CF" and is less commonly known compared to more prominent currencies like the US dollar or the Euro.

One of the unique aspects of the Comoros Franc is its relative stability despite the country's economic challenges. The Comoros relies heavily on agriculture, tourism, and fishing. Economic performance can be influenced by political changes, natural disasters, and global market trends, which can impact the value of the Comoros Franc.
